Transaction 153641ae005217a664f942b988ebb67a8562d3c7e91e88a2ba6b192a77ca331c
1 Input
1 Output
-
153641ae005217a664f942b988ebb67a8562d3c7e91e88a2ba6b192a77ca331c:0
- value
- 6810544
- script pubkey
- OP_0 OP_PUSHBYTES_20 48c25ff62f7ce4e42f96814f6300c84c92586de6
- address
- bc1qfrp9la300njwgtuks98kxqxgfjf9sm0xesjy0f